La poussette Z4 de Peg Perego, avec son nouveau look dynamique, offre plus d'agilité sur la route, dans les espaces étroits ou dans les zones très fréquentées. Utilisé avec un siège complet, avec notre siège auto Primo Viaggio 4-35 Nido [vendu séparément] ou avec un berceau Z4 [vendu séparément], le Z4 fera de la promenade avec votre bébé une joie. Notre amour du détail ne passera pas inaperçu, donnant au Z4 un style épuré et raffiné.Le Z4 ne mesure que 20" de large, parfait pour les aventures où l'espace est limité. La conception épurée du châssis rend les manœuvres dans la foule plus faciles et plus pratiques. La poignée télescopique s'adapte aux utilisateurs de différentes hauteurs et la barre en cuir écologique cousue à la main ajoute une touche d'élégance.Les roues ont un système de suspension et 12 roulements à billes, ce qui signifie qu'elles sont 30% plus faciles à pousser et peuvent affronter différentes surfaces.
La conception simplifiée du Z4 lui permet d'être manœuvré facilement dans un trafic intense sur les trottoirs, les allées étroites et les ascenseurs bondés. La capuche est réglable en hauteur et suit la croissance de bébé tout en contenant UPF 50+.
Caractéristiques:
- La conception innovante permet un pliage rapide et facile et se ferme vers l'intérieur, gardant toujours le revêtement propre.
- Pour transformer en poussette double, ajoutez un siège compagnon et un adaptateur double [tous deux vendus séparément]
- Les roues avec roulements à billes et suspension permettent une agilité à 360 degrés et moins d'effort pour pousser
- Le dossier peut être réglé sur trois positions : assise, relaxante et repos
- UPF 50+ Capuche réglable en hauteur (2 1/2” / 6,3 cm) qui suit la croissance de bébé
- Roues avant pivotantes verrouillables avec freins arrière indépendants « en une étape »
- Le dossier peut être réglé dans trois positions confortables : assise, relaxante et repos
- Permet de pousser facilement d'une seule main
- Le guidon peut être modifié en trois positions pour s'adapter aux préférences de taille des parents. Faites-en un système de voyage avec le siège auto Primo Viaggio 4-35 Nido.
Caractéristiques:
- Convient aux enfants pesant jusqu'à 50 lb et mesurant 43 pouces
- Poids de la poussette : 22,5 lb
- Dimensions déplié : 20" x 39,25" x 40,25"
- Dimensions plié : 20" x 32,25" x 15,25"
